In support of the initiative, the U.S. Department of State launched the Academy for Women Entrepreneurs (AWE), providing an opportunity of entrepreneurship training for women-led startups, and women who are preparing for startups and are interested in entrepreneurship in Taiwan.
The U.S. government launched the Women’s Global Development & Prosperity Initiative (W-GDP), strengthening women’s economic and political empowerment to increase the prospect of women’s economic empowerment.
The program combines local business characteristics and includes events and gatherings to strengthen networking between women-led startups, increase opportunities to expand business in Taiwan and the U.S., and establish an entrepreneurial ecosystem for women- owned companies.
With a series of courses on the massive open online course (MOOC) platform DreamBuilder and the involvement of Taiwan women business leaders or entrepreneurs, the program encourages entrepreneurship discussions in order to cultivate entrepreneurial know-how, help women entrepreneurs connect with industries or entrepreneurial resources, enhance opportunities for business expansion, and increase the likelihood of entrepreneurial success. The training program includes: thirteen online entrepreneurship courses, six women entrepreneur meet-ups, and one large forum. Participants who complete the DreamBuilder courses by the 29th of October, 2021 and attend at least two in-person events and the November 19th closing ceremony/forum will be added to the U.S. exchange program alumni database as priority guests for future U.S. business exchange events.
